The transportation of residents to and from hospitals, doctor’s offices, dialysis centers, medical offices, private homes, social functions, and Bishop Spencer activities in a safe and professional manner. Drivers will be responsible for keeping vehicles and equipment maintained, ensure vehicle is safe to operate and complete all required forms. Maintain a professional appearance adhering to the BSP dress code. Maintain a professional and courteous service attitude while adhering to BSP’s professional code of ethics.
Requirements
Current Missouri Class E or Kansas driver’s license Pass all BSP background checks Pass drug test Pass physical CPR certified Knowledge of Kansas City / Plaza area Good communication skills Able to multi-task and handle a fast pace work environment Passionate about caring for seniors Good customer service Outgoing and friendly demeanor
Duties
Transporting residents in a safe a professional manner. Works with dispatcher to coordinate transportation requests in a timely and efficient manner. Communicates with dispatcher and fellow drivers to receive relevant data and instructions. Maintain a professional behavior, and attitudes in regards to residents, staff, and visitors. Completion of vehicle inspection prior to daily usage for safe and comfortable resident transportation. Assist with transferring and balancing residents. Caring for BSP vehicles - cleaning, washing and fueling Capable of understanding directions and the ability to use maps accurately Maintains a professional appearance Adheres to BSP uniform requirements Perform all duties as assigned
